Best Michigan Women's Volleyball Programs, Ranked by Affordability
A big scholarship means less if the sticker price is even bigger. Below, we've ranked all 52 Michigan women's Volleyball programs by affordability score — a composite that weighs net price and aid together to show how realistic the total cost picture looks.
The average net price across Michigan women's Volleyball programs is $14,751, with average aid of $8,600 per athlete.
